When an individual has overcome substance abuse problem, it's not as easy as picking up where you left off. Returning to a stable and happy life takes time and a lot of effort. A Halfway House, also called a Sober Living Facility, is a setting where people in recovery can live in a sober and positive environment until they can live confidently on their own. Living in a Halfway House may be a condition of a person's probation for example, or someone may make the decision to live in a Halfway House of their own accord following drug or alcohol rehab. In either case, occupants of a Halfway House are clean and sober and striving to do what they need to do to get their lives back on track. This could mean finishing school, getting a job, etc.

Halfway Houses in River Falls are run by people who in many cases were once residents of the house. How long a person is allowed to stay at the Halfway House can vary, but it's typically anywhere from a month to a couple of years. Tenants are required to undergo drug and alcohol testing prior to being accepted into the house, and this testing will take place randomly to ensure there isn't any drug use in the house or substance abuse issues that would be more effectively dealt with in an addiction rehabilitation program.
